Desktop PC has three monitors, two are just static Images from Wallhaven. Primary is using another KDE plugin that reuses Wallpaper Engine themes I’m subscribed to via Steam back when I used Windows… somewhat. Don’t recommend because it’s prone to crashing when a theme is incompatible and you have to edit a config file to remove the broken paper entry to get your taskbar responsive again. I trial and errored until I just had a handful of my old favourites that work.
